Output 9313b8184c6da8d33a74b4d52ef36e45e407f94e09368d128d1a454bbe7ff78e:2

value
28520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a37471880c3aaf61779c188dde3dcd936dceda3 OP_EQUAL
address
3QW35GJ5MDsfkmGYezY6cZAn4Ms3XVR7q9
transaction
9313b8184c6da8d33a74b4d52ef36e45e407f94e09368d128d1a454bbe7ff78e
confirmations
278455
spent
true